I think there's two types of outrage happening here:

-People are mad that things are being put into the game untested not just one time but many times over the last year or so

This part is justifiably frustrating and people should be irked. We as players pay for a live service, and we should expect things that get put into the game to work and function as intended. I would argue that testing XP rates to make sure they're not too high or low (or even testing for basic functionality) is part of this. One time is one time; multiple times is a pattern.

-People are mad that the most recent untested thing was taken away because it offered very appealing XP rates that were unintentional and now they don't get to partake in the crazy XP/hr.

This rage isn't justifiable imo. If they left this in the game this method eclipses the previous best mining XP/hr by more than double (if the 224khr that I saw wasn't just a meme) and immediately becomes the main method people level mining with once they unlock rubium splinters. That creates an issue that this sub has complained about many times before with certain older content being shunned/outdone by newer updates. The whole "only 1% of players are using tick manipulation" argument is disingenuous; OSRS has some of the most creative and resourceful players out of any game I'm not saying every player uses tick manipulation, but it's definitely not "just 1%".

The real issue: there are certain skills in the game that are very clearly dated and have received less attention in terms up updates and alternative leveling methods. Mining (and smithing) are both infamously bad compared to other skills in OSRS and even bad compared to how they are in RS3. Motherlode mine isn't a fun activity; it's a slog everyone deals with for some inventory expansion items and some XP boosting armor. Blast furnace isn't that much better. Giant's Foundry is a bit more in the right direction but still isn't on par with Zalcano/WT. I think there should be an emphasis on reworking smithing and mining to modern standards, even if it means just copying some of RS3s design choices.

Sorry not the best video. but if anyone is interested in how the new steam controller plays with osrs, out of the box here, you go! by Nutty103X in 2007scape

[–]lieutenantowned 1 point2 points  (0 children)

OLED deck user here, glad this works just as good as the controls on the deck. The game plays really well with the track pads and back buttons for your F keys but it can be tricky being precise with your clicks using the track pads.

A word of caution about the programmable steam input though: I'm fairly certain that using the "toggle" mode as well as "turbo" mode for your clicks can be considered bannable; another person I know with the deck did catch a ban for using it.
